In revamping their Paris duplex, designer Rafael de Cárdenas (on the right) and his partner, Cale Harrison, doubled down on the ascetic vibe of the modest space. The Elémentaire armchairs are by Jean Nouvel for Ligne Roset, and the red lamp is by Andrée Putman.
